1995 E150 wheel specs Or stock Ford 5x5.5 x16 steels 4 sale?

I know that wheels and tyres are a tricky topic to bring up but I have a recently discovered problem on my new, to me, 1995 E150 Quigley. And I have searched but could not get any specifications, just lots and lots of random tyre/tire threads. My van has the stock Ford 15 inch alloys from the period, fitted with BFG AT's in 31 x10.5.

I need to know the specs for the stock rims. I know the pattern is 5 x 5.5 but does anyone know the rim width and offset?

I need to know because I was getting some funny grinding/rubbing noises on full lock that on first inspection seemed to be tyre rubbing. It has continued to get worse and it's clear now that my steering knuckle actually rubs on the rim quite hard at full lock in either direction. I really don't want to have to drop another small fortune on wheels and tyres so am thinking of finding something that will fit from a take-off someone has done to upgrade their own wheels. 16 inch stock steel 5 hole Ford rims would be fine for me, actually preferable to alloy, but most of what I can find is from Dodge or Ford trucks that have the same bolt pattern but unknown offset.

If someone can help me save trial fitting multiple sets of wheels it would be much appreciated.
